Different types of gardening tools work by leveraging specific mechanisms designed to enhance efficiency and ease in tasks like planting, weeding, and pruning.

Understanding the Mechanisms

At the core of gardening tools, their functionality stems from a combination of design and material. For instance, a shovel's broad, sturdy blade allows for easy digging and transferring of soil, while a rake's tines are engineered to gather leaves and debris efficiently. The subtle elements, such as the angle of the handle or the weight distribution, contribute significantly to how effectively a tool can be used. Each design meticulously considers the task at hand, ensuring that even novice gardeners can use them with relative ease.

Types of Gardening Tools

Hand Tools

Hand tools like trowels, pruners, and weeders rely on simple physics. For example, pruners function on a scissor mechanism, where the strength of the user’s hand multiplies the cutting power, allowing for clean cuts on stems. These tools are essential for small precision tasks and are typically made from stainless steel for durability and rust resistance.

Power Tools

On the other hand, power tools such as tillers and lawn mowers operate on more advanced principles. A tiller, for instance, uses rotating blades powered by an engine to break up soil, significantly expediting the preparation for planting. The shift from hand-operated to powered tools has revolutionized gardening, making it accessible to those who may not have the physical strength required for manual labor.
